Scar Mini Bio David Hodo was born on July 7, 1947 in San Andreas, California, USA. He is an actor, known for Can't Stop the Music (1980), Married. with Children (1987) and New York, New York (1967). Trademarks Village People construction worker. Trivia Graduated from Sacramento State College with a B.A. in Speech.

David Hodo, the original Construction Man (he took a leave from the group for a few years in the mid-1980's). Jeff Olson, who replaced Randy Jones as the Cowboy in 1980, just after Can't Stop the Music. Eric Anzalone, who became the group's Biker/Leatherman in 1995, after the death from lung cancer of original member Glenn Hughes.

David Hodo was born in Hollywood Hills, California on July 7, 1947. From 1978 to 2013, Hodo secured his place in Pop Culture as the construction worker character in the group Village People. Prior to that, Hodo performed as a chorus member in numerous Broadway musicals, including "Funny Girl".
